Although JPEG is the standard format for saving images to your digital camera, hard drive, and email, it is a good idea to save your scanned photograph files as TIFF rather than JPEG because TIFF files do not lose resolution each time you open, close, and save a file. You can think of a JPEG file as a kind of compressed file which loses resolution each time it is used.
